Stalling at Start-abates when warmed up

I have a 1999 Ford F150 Triton V8 5.4l with 127,000 miles~

Especially when temperature drops below 60 degrees I will encounter this problem.

At startup, vehicle will idle very low (500-600) and almost always stall out. in order to start vehicle, i will have to step on gas-which inevitably sends a puff of white smoke. During the warmup period, I will smell sweet gas odor. I have found it best to keep my foot on the gas, so it revs at approximately 1000 rpm's until vehicle is warmed up. If I don't it may, or may not, continue to run. If it ceases to run, it will go up and down on the idle running 600rpms at the tops and down to 300rpms until it just stalls.

Additionally, I am now hearing a rattling noise under the hood. When facing the truck, it comes from the area of the COPS on the left-but I can't narrow it down any further. And another new problem is the truck rumbling sometimes when warmed up-as though truck is skipping a beat (plugs?)

Any advice on what to check, I would appreciate it.

I can follow instructions fairly well, but my mechanical knowledge is limited at best-so if possible, please try to be as descriptive as possible.

You have a weak IAC - Idle Air Control. You can get one at any parts house, but the factory part seems to last much longer, although more $$$.
